Hi, I’m Finn, i'm a designer and a researcher. My work focusses on the development of regenerative cultures. I'm passionate about connecting people back to Nature and building resilience to navigate the environmental breakdown ahead.
I’m the co-founder and Chief Designer of Juntos Farm, a new community space in the heart of Ibiza focused on regenerative farming and local food production. We’re on a mission to put the ‘culture’ back in agriculture through a dynamic model of farming, food and community.
I’m also the co-founder of Earthrise Studio, I work alongside Jack Harries and Alice Aedy to explore innovative ways of communicating about climate, culture, and consciousness through digital media. Our mission is to inspire new perspectives and actions that address the pressing challenges of our time.
I have a background in storytelling. I began making films in 2011, co-creating JacksGap with Jack Harries. This project took me around the world, opening up my eyes to so many different cultures and ways of life. In 2015 I moved to New York, to study Architectural Design and Environmental Studies at Parsons School of Design. I wanted to develop a more practical skill set for shaping the world around me.
I continued my education at the Architectural Association in London finishing my RIBA Part 1 accreditation. In 2019, I pursued a Master of Philosophy in Architecture and Urban Design at the University of Cambridge. My research thesis was on design for regenerative systems, developing frameworks for navigating climate breakdown. I graduated with my RIBA Part 2.
In addition to my design work, I have shared my insights on climate urgency through talks at TEDx and the United Nations, and my writing has appeared in publications such as The Guardian and Citizen Magazine.
